NEW INGREDIENT INTRODUCTIONS Learn More ACTIVES – HIGH PERFORMANCETECHNOLOGY Learn … WebNov 29, 2008 · The trinity is always onion, bell pepper and celery. When garlic is included, it is referred to as the trinity with the pope, or in New Orleans vernacular, wit da Pope. … Once your trinity is chopped, sauté it in olive oil until the onions are translucent, then you'd add some minced garlic along with your seasonings, like salt, pepper, cayenne, and paprika. Reduce the heat, add some butter, then stir in an equal amount of flour to form a roux.
